WebReckless driving – 4 points. Speeding that causes a crash – 6 points. Leaving the scene of an accident with property damage over $50 – 6 points. If you’ve incurred points on your … WebLeaving a crash scene that resulted in property damages worth over $50, you will get 6 points. Unlawful speed that results in a vehicle crash will add 6 points. Reckless driving and criminal traffic violations will provide 4 points. Passing stopped school bus will guarantee you 4 points.

Web27 nov. 2024 · Speeding is generally considered a three-point offense. That said, if the driver was driving at extremely high speeds or swerving in and out of lanes, they may … Web21 nov. 2024 · Florida law permits enforcement of a 15-20 mph speed limit in a school zone. This speed limit is enforceable for 30 minutes before, during, and after students arrive and leave school.
